What Is Semi Open Rhinoplasty?

Semi Open Rhinoplasty is a surgical technique that involves creating internal incisions inside both nostrils, allowing the surgeon to access and adjust certain underlying nasal structures.

By improving visibility and allowing more detailed assessment of the nasal structure, the surgeon can plan adjustments that are better suited to each individual’s anatomy.

However, choosing the Semi Open technique does not mean it is suitable for everyone. The most appropriate technique should be determined based on each person’s existing nasal structure, goals, and specific needs.

How Is Semi Open Different from Closed Rhinoplasty?

Closed Rhinoplasty is a technique where all incisions are made inside the nostrils, without any external incision.

This technique may be suitable for individuals who require certain nose shape adjustments without the need for extensive structural modification.

On the other hand, Semi Open Rhinoplasty provides additional access for structural adjustments, allowing the surgeon to evaluate and refine the nose in greater detail when appropriate.

Both techniques have their own advantages and limitations. Therefore, the choice of technique should be based on individual suitability rather than selecting a technique based on its name alone.
